Security Now (Audio) - SN 957: The Protected Audience API - Hacked Washing Machine, Quantum Crypto Troubles

SN 957: The Protected Audience API - Hacked Washing Machine, Quantum Crypto Troubles

01/16/24 • 105 min

Security Now (Audio)
  • What would an IoT device look like that HAD been taken over?
  • And speaking of DDoS attacks
  • Trouble in the Quantum Crypto world
  • The Browser Monoculture
  • Question about the Apple backdoor
  • Getting into infosec
  • proton drive vs sync
  • SpinRite update
  • The Protected Audience API

Show Notes - https://www.grc.com/sn/SN-957-Notes.pdf

Hosts: Steve Gibson and Leo Laporte
